The Origin of a Tech Giant

The story of the Google company name is inseparable from the mathematical principle behind its founding algorithm. In 1998, Larry Page and Sergey Brin sought to create a more efficient way to navigate the burgeoning internet. They named their search engine "Google," a deliberate misspelling of "googol," the mathematical term for the number 1 followed by 100 zeros. This nomenclature was not merely clever branding; it was a direct expression of the company's ambition to handle an immense scale of data, effectively mapping the infinite expanse of the World Wide Web.

Beyond the Search Engine

While the search engine remains the cornerstone of the Google company name, the entity has long since transcended its initial product. The moniker now encompasses a vast ecosystem of services that permeate daily life. From the Android operating system that powers the majority of smartphones to the Chrome browser that dictates web standards, the identity of "Google" has expanded to signify a comprehensive suite of digital tools designed for productivity, communication, and entertainment.

The Ecosystem Integration

Modern users interact with the Google company name through a layered integration of services that work seamlessly in the background. Gmail handles personal correspondence, Google Drive provides cloud storage, and YouTube dominates video content. This interconnectedness creates a cohesive user experience, where data flows freely between platforms. The convenience of this ecosystem reinforces brand loyalty, making the name synonymous with a centralized digital lifestyle rather than a single search tool.

Corporate Structure and Rebranding

To manage its sprawling influence, the Google company name underwent a significant structural change in 2015. The creation of Alphabet Inc. positioned Google as the leading subsidiary of a larger conglomerate. This move was designed to clarify the distinction between the core search and advertising business and the "moonshot" ventures pursued by X, the company's secretive research and development division. The public-facing Google brand, however, remained the primary vessel for consumer interaction, ensuring the name retained its friendly, accessible association.

The Weight of Responsibility

The global dominance of the Google company name carries significant ethical and societal weight. As the primary gateway to information, the search engine influences public opinion, shapes political discourse, and determines economic visibility. This power has led to intense scrutiny regarding privacy, antitrust regulations, and the algorithms that govern content visibility. The company name is therefore burdened with the responsibility of balancing profit motives with the public good, a challenge that defines its modern legacy.
